two.1.4) Short description

Jisc has entered into a contract with S&P to provide Jisc member institutions with the opportunity to license content published by S&P with preferential pricing. The service is being contracted on behalf of our members and not for Jisc’s own use.

Institutions can subscribe to one of the following: S&P Capital IQ platform: provides tools, data and research for finance graduates, investors and analysts. SNL platform: industry-specific intelligence for specialised data, flexible tools and real-time financial news covering banks and insurance companies across the globe .

two.2.14) Additional information

The contract value is an estimate based on the aggregate sum of the licence fees that will be paid to the supplier by Jisc member institutions over the one year term of the contract. Jisc itself makes no payment to the supplier for this service.

Explanation:

The publishing service and content is unique to the supplier. Therefore Jisc is clear that the arrangement falls within the protection of exclusive rights, including intellectual property rights, contained within Regulation 32 (2) (b) (iii) of the Public Contracts Regulations2015,permitting Jisc to enter into the direct award.
